  • The purpose of this study was to identify and to trace the origins and meanings of sok (速) and bosal (菩薩). Comparative linguistic analytical approches were employed for this research. The analysis of this study indicted that sok (速) of Koryo was derived from sok (速) of Chinese. the phonetic value of sok (速) and sok (速) in Chinese are su⁴. The word sok (粟) refers to kok 곡 (穀) and kok (穀) refers to ra (羅). The bosal (菩薩) of Koroyo was related ot textile terminologies of many languages such as Hebrew, Mongolic, Manchu, Gilyak, Turkish and so on. Therefore, the bosal of Koryo was identified as a fabric term used in Koryo.

  • This study excludes how to define the concepts and categories of the Ah-ak(雅樂) and Sok-ak(俗樂). In the process from the early Joseon Dynasty to the late Joseon Dynasty, the aesthetic appreciation system of the Ah-Sok(雅俗) in traditional music, which is consistently projected on court music and folk music centered on Pungryubang, was revealed through specific historical records. Through this study, we were able to examine as follow : In the early Joseon Dynasty, the aesthetic of music related to the the Ah-Sok(雅俗) was mainly projected on the court's ritual music and Yeonhyangak-music for korean court banquet-, and in particular, the aesthetic thoughts of Geomungo[玄琴] was at the center. As we descend to the late Joseon Dynasty, the aesthetic of music related to the Ah-Sok(雅俗) has been expanded to the private sector, reflecting the aesthetic of Pungryubang music, and it can be seen that the aesthetic thought of Geomungo[玄琴] was at the center.

  • Hypothalamus is one of the most important center regulating voluntary and involuntary function of the body. We studied on the blood glucose and eosinophilic responses induced by electrical hypothalamic stimulation using stereotaxic apparatus. Blood glucose was measured according to Somogyi Nelson method and circulating eosinophil was counted with Hinkleman Stain. For the histological confirmation of electrode placement frozen sections were cut along electrode tract and stained with Hematoxylin-Eosin. The results obtained were as follows: 1. Anterior hypothalamic stimulation mostly leads to hypoglycemia but in some cases lead to hyperglycemia. 2. Hypothalamic stimulation leads to eosinopenia in majority cases. 3. There is no relationship between eosinopenia and hyperglycemia. 4. It appears that sympathetic and pararympathetic areas are not separate part but it coincides each other.

  • In order to find out the effects of GABA on the rabbit's intestinal motility, the following experiments were carried out using Magnus method and the results obtained were as follows: 1. GABA inhibited the intestinal motility of rabbits initially. 2. GABA potentiated the inhibitory action of adrenaline and nor-adrenaline. 3. GABA inhibited the accelerating activity of acetylcholine on the intestinal motility by its anti acetylcholine effect. 4. The inhibitory action of GABA was unaffected with atropinization, strychnin, picrotoxin treatment, but the accelerating activity of GABA observed in some cases was only in the picrotoxin treatment.

  • This paper is to make a comparative study between George Sand and Na Hye-sok through their lives and works. The research found that George Sand and Na Hye-sok had similar views about the institution and social system of their age. Both women were aware of importance and necessity of education and the arts but showed a clear distinction between their beliefs in education and the arts. George Sand found that education was an indispensable part of women's lives but found that educationforwomentotheageofSandwasuseless. For this reason she continued to assert a substantial reform concerning women's education. In addition, she argued that everyone should have been given the same opportunities regardless of gender or class. Na Hye-sok, meanwhile, looked at women's education in a more realistic perspective, that is to say to make money. The two women showed remarkable differences in the view of art. This is evident from the presence of a responsibility and a sense of purpose as an artist. George Sand was imbued with a sense of purpose and clarified her own belief at the beginning of her activities as a writer. She wanted to inform the suffering of the weak through her writing and to contribute to build a Utopia where everyone could be happy to live beyond the boundaries of gender. However, Na Hye-sok did not reveal her own clear sense of purpose to her art activities. Art is not just a job - it's a vocation. Na Hye-sok was enthusiastic but didn't have a sense of purpose. She should have had a vocation and a sense of purpose. Na Hye-sok was lacking of responsibilities and obligations as a pioneer of Western painting. If there were a distinct vocation and a sense of purpose to Na Hye-sok as an artist, she would have left a trail as valuable as that of George Sand.

  • In order to investigate the effect of autonomic nervous system on salivary gland, the authors have observed the effects of various drugs acting on the autonomic nervous system to the rat submaxillary gland by comparing the changes of gland weight, the amylase activity and various electrolyte contents with control group. The results are as follows; 1. The pilocarpine, physostigmine, norepinephrine, atropine and DMPP increased the rat submaxillary gland weight. 2. The amylase activities of rat submaxillary gland were increased by pilocarpine, physostigmine and norepinephrine, but decreased by atropine and DMPP. 3. Calcium contents of rat submaxillary gland were highly increased by pilocarpine and physostigmine, hut slightly increased by norepinephrine. 4. Magnesium contents of rat submarillary gland were increased by DMPP, but decreased by pilocarpine, physostigmine and norepinephrine. 5. Sodium contents of rat subnaxillary gland were increased by pilocarpine, physostigmine, norepinephrine and DMPP, but decreased by atropine. 6. Potassium contents of rat submaxillary gland were highly increased by atropine, and slightly increased by DMPP and norepinephrine, but decreased by pilocarpine and physostigmine.

  • Alloxan is a well known diabetogenic agent which destroys the beta-cell of the Langerhan's islet. The authors investigated the influence of the repeated infusion of glucose solution upon the toxicity of alloxan in the mice. The effects of glucose on the blood sugar content and the serum transaminase (S-GOT and S-GPT) activities in the rabbits treated with alloxan were also observed. The results were as follows: 1. The $LD_{50}$ of alloxan in mice showed a slight decrease by pretreatment with glucose for one or two weeks. 2. The elevated blood sugar level in rabbits induced by alloxan shelved a significant fall for the first 3 days by pretreatment with glucose. 3. The increased serum transaminase activities in rabbits induced by alloxan decreased for the first 3 days by pretreatment with glucose.

  • In order to study the electrocardiogram of small animals authors deviced a fixing apparatus in the ventral resting position of rabbit and an attaching electrodes. Normal electrocardiograms of 8 adult rabbits were studied with author's improved fixing apparatus and electrodes. Leads taken were the standard limb lead, augmented unipolar leads and the unipolar precordial leads. The total numbers of various leads were eleven altogether. Results obtained in this study may be summarized as follows: 1. The details of the methods used to record and measure the six standard frontal plane leads and the five precordial leads of the rabbit electrocardiogram in the ventral resting position were described. The fixing apparatus of rabbits in ventral position are shown in Figure 1 and the attaching electrodes are shown in Figure 2. 2. The electrocardiographic changes in ventral position were more stable than in dorsal position in each lead. 3. The analysis of the amplitude, duration and other values of various waves are shown in Table 1 and Figure 3. 4. The electrocardiogram of rabbits showed decreased heart rate in ventral position than dorsal one. 5. The mean electrical axis of QRS complex in ventral position were +44.12 degrees and in dorsal position were +25.5 degrees.
